The University of Central Missouri invites the campus and local community to attend the annual Pre-Memorial Day Ceremony at 11 a.m. Wednesday, May 20 on the east side lawn of the Alumni Memorial Chapel.

Maj. Gen. Stephen L. Danner, adjutant general of the Missouri National Guard, will be the keynote speaker. The ceremony also includes a “Moment of Reflection,” presented by Col. Gary D. Gilmore, Missouri National Guard joint services chaplain; recognition for individuals who lost their lives serving this country by Lt. Col. Philip Dan Cureton, chair of the UCM Department of Military Science, and honor given to those soldiers who were prisoners of war or missing in action featuring the Whiteman Air Force Base Color Guard. The Missouri Army National Guard also will present colors during the event. The Columbia Vet Center also will be available from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. on May 20 to provide veterans with health care information and assist them with signing up for VA benefits. Its mobile unit will be parked near the Elliott Student Union mall, outside the Military and Veterans Success Center on the north side of the building. Additionally, representatives from the Kansas City VA Medical Center will be available from 10 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. to provide health care information.

The Harmon College of Business and Professional Studies at the University of Central Missouri will formally dedicate the Donn G. Forbes Center for Financial Services with a ribbon-cutting ceremony at 10:30 a.m. Friday, May 15, in Ward Edwards 1604. The public is invited to attend.

The center, made possible through generosity of UCM alumnus Donn G. Forbes, will become the dedicated home of Student Investment Fund, a student investment group. Formed in the fall of 2013, the team of undergraduate and graduate students enrolled for course credit gain realistic experience by performing detailed investment analyses and investing funding allocated by the UCM Foundation. Funds generated through investment generate additional dollars for UCM Foundation scholarships.
